3 Chain Links for Jewellery Making

Learn how to create 3 types of chain links for jewellery making with this step by step tutorial.
These links can be connected together to make necklace chains and bracelets, or you could use them individually in, say, earrings or one either side of a focal necklace element. The only limit is your imagination!
Twisted Bar Link
Materials: Copper wire 2mm diameter (12 gauge), Jumprings.
Tools: Wire cutters; Hammers and block; Centre punch; Drill; File; Polishing tools.
Wrapped Bead Link
Materials: Copper wire 0.4mm diameter (26 gauge), Beads, Jumprings.
Tools: Round nose pliers, Wire cutters, Flat nose pliers (optional).
Double Link
Materials: Copper wire 0.9mm diameter (19 gauge), Jumprings.
Tools: Wire cutters, Bail-making pliers, Hammer and block.
